    Stephanie L.

    I ate at Sammy's Cafe today and had the 3x3 breakfast for $19.99. Great value and definitely shareable. It came with 3 eggs, 2 bacon, 2 sausage, choice of country potatoes or hash browns, and choice of 1/2 order of chocolate chip pancake, banana French toast, strawberry waffle, and one other option. I really enjoyed the banana French toast. I ate it without syrup. The country potatoes were lightly seasoned, which I loved. My eggs, sausage, ham, and bacon were all cooked perfectly. I would definitely get this meal again but share it because I didn't even eat half of it. The service was really great. They sat us quickly and took our drink order right away. Not long after, they came back to take our order and our food was out within 10min. The inside of the restaurant could use a serious face lift. The seat cushioning is kinda warm and low to the ground but still ok to sit on. This place would be great if you needed to seat a large part because it's very spacious inside. Consider checking this place out. They have a large diner menu.
